Test of Endurance: Bordeaux 2014 Ten Years On (Mar 2024)

The 2014 Giscours has a composed bouquet with black cherries, violet and light forest floor scents. The oak is nicely integrated. The palate is medium-bodied with supple tannins, fleshier than its peers, though it doesn’t have the acidity to maintain sufficient freshness. This feels a bit chewy on the finish, as if trying too hard….
